Western Sahara - Whole Fresh Goat Milk Producing Population
Since 2014, Western Sahara Whole Fresh Goat Milk Producing Population decreased by 1.3%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 75 comparing other countries in Whole Fresh Goat Milk Producing Population at 82,218 Heads. Western Sahara is overtaken by Israel, which was number 74 with 83,780 Heads and is followed by South Korea with 81,992 Heads. India lead the ranking with 32,565,773 Heads in 2019, that is a decrease of 11.6% versus 2018. Bangladesh, Mali and Indonesia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Portugal witnessed the best average annual growth at +40.5% per year, while Kyrgyzstan was the worst growing country at -22.7% per year.
